A tunnel at two hundred kilometers an hour, no seatbelt on his faith. A car thrown off a highway at 4am, a friend who never woke up. Two people who told God they didn't need Him - both still standing here. This episode is for anyone convinced God has gone quiet on them. Kevin and Kavita walk through three seasons of silence from their own lives - the reckless years before either of them was listening, the long wait for each other, and the financial wilderness they first told you about in Episode 2, revisited from the inside of the silence itself. Kavita shares the night she flew through a car window and lived. Kevin shares what it felt like to pray for a wife for years and hear nothing back. God was not silent. They just couldn't hear Him yet. Silence is not absence. This is Episode 7 of Through Everything — Season 1 of His Faithfulness. "He was faithful. He is faithful. | Raising Boys With God | 19 juil. 2026 | 00:30:29 | |
"When I am not in the picture, you are six. When I am in the picture, you are seven." What God said to Kevin about their family changed how he and Kavita parent - because your family is a living barometer of God's presence, and you can feel it in the room on an ordinary Tuesday evening. In this episode, Kevin and Kavita open up the deliberate architecture of a faith-filled home: why they never taught their four boys to recite prayers, the difference between praying TO God and talking WITH God, what an eight-year-old leading a room full of adults in prayer taught them about planting, and what happens when your three-year-old reflects your least flattering habits back at you - in his sleep. | A Mother's Story | 12 juil. 2026 | 00:35:30 | |
Nobody hands you a guidebook when you become a mother. Kavita didn't have one — and she didn't have a template to copy either. She was building something for her boys that nobody had ever built for her. In this episode, Kevin turns the conversation to Kavita and asks her what motherhood has actually been like — the exhaustion of those early years with Tristan, learning to draw the line when everyone had an opinion, the food "boot camp" that turned four boys into children who eat everything, and what it takes to hold it together on an ordinary Wednesday when no miracle is in sight. It's honest about the hard parts. They don't have perfect children, and they'll tell you they're not perfect parents. But woven through all of it is the one thing Kavita says makes the difference: you have to put God in your children's lives from the very beginning. Everything else comes after that. This is the episode for the mother who is carrying it alone, running on no sleep, and wondering if she's getting any of it right. Kavita's answer: be calm. Good things are about to happen. | A Medical Miracle | 05 juil. 2026 | 00:42:50 | |
The doctors said 12 to 24 months before she would learn to walk and talk again. A month later, she walked into the doctor's office on her own and answered every question he asked. No medication. No surgery. Just prayer. This episode is for anyone who has run out of options. Kevin and Kavita share the night of the phone call, the scramble to bring Mum home, the WWE match at 4am, and what happened when a family with nothing left to fall back on gathered around a hospital bed and prayed. | Our Story | 14 juin 2026 | 00:39:21 | |
Some stories don't start in church. They start in a dark room, a hospital ward, and a tiny village outside Madrid. This is ours. Kevin grew up in a pastor's family in Malaysia — faith was everywhere, but somewhere in his teens, it stopped being his. It took years of God showing up in small, undeniable ways to bring him back. Even then, success and money made it easy to think he didn't really need Him. Kavita grew up with nothing — no faith, no map, no blueprint. At eight years old, in the dark, frightened for her mother's life, she prayed for the first time and felt something she couldn't explain. Years later, after losing her mother and walking away from God entirely, she found herself sitting alone in a church every week, not knowing how to pray, just knowing she had to keep coming back. God had been walking them towards each other their entire lives. This is Episode 1 of Through Everything — Season 1 of His Faithfulness. "He was faithful. He is faithful.
